## Runbook: Query planner regression (Stonereach DB)

Symptom: p99 latency spikes on join-heavy queries after deploy. Check planner version first — regressions usually trace to a stats-refresh change, not data. Mitigation: pin the planner to the previous profile via the feature flag, then re-run the canary query set. Do not rebuild stats mid-incident. Escalate if pinning doesn't recover within ten minutes. Pinned build token follows below.

session token of kageg-tahop = htk14_af3c1ccccb7dcf

## Runbook: Digest Scheduler Release (Mistflow)

Plugin authors: batch email digests ship via the Mistflow cron tier. Tag your plugin, run the bundle step, confirm the schedule manifest validates. Digests queue hourly; off-peak windows only. All plugin bundles must be signed before upload or the scheduler rejects them. Sign using the following key.

release key, fahaf-bajof: bky3_Xam

Onboarding — Liftwright Simulator

Liftwright models dispatch for up to 40 cars across the Penhale tower profiles. Clone the repo, run `make scenarios`, then start the Kestrel UI to watch queue heatmaps. Core logic lives in the dispatcher module; don't edit the physics tables without sign-off from Oren. Regression suite runs nightly; results post to the sync channel. Scenario seeds are deterministic — never randomize in CI. To unlock the archived scenario vault for historical benchmarks, enter the recovery passphrase, which is:

vault phrase of bagaf-kajeg = jorath-feniel-briir-siliel-ralix

Subject: DR Drill — Websocket Compression Decision

Hi Maren,

During Friday's disaster-recovery drill for Quillhaven, we'll test failover with permessage-deflate disabled. Compression cuts bandwidth roughly 60% on our feed, but it adds CPU load at exactly the moment the standby node is weakest, and we saw frame stalls in the last rehearsal. I recommend shipping the drill build with compression off and revisiting after capacity review. To unlock the standby vault during the drill, use the passphrase noted below.

strongbox words: sorir-belvan-rusix-ulays-ralmir-praix-eliir-tamax-praael-druael-julir-tamius-jorir